2011-08-12 9 views
0

HTMLでXMLファイルからコンテンツを解析して表示する実績のある方法は何ですか? PHPでこれを行う方法はありますか? Javascript?これは、ほとんどのWebアプリケーションが応答XMLファイルの解析を通じてAPIとやり取りする方法ですか?XMLからHTMLへのメソッド

+0

あなたの質問はあまりにも曖昧です。 XMLは単なるコンテナ形式であり、任意のツリー構造を持つものをすべて含むことができます。したがって、XMLをバイナリファイルに変換する方法は*と似ています。 –

+0

XMLファイルから値を解析し、HTMLタグ内に表示するにはどうすればよいですか? – 585connor

+0

私はこの質問は、ほとんどのWebブラウザがデフォルトでそれらを表示する方法で、すてきな色とインデントでXMLツリーをきれいに印刷することだと思います。右?これが確かに問題であれば、XSLTを書くか、GolexTrolが示唆している選択肢を使用してください。 –

答えて

2

JQueryを使用してXMLを解析できます。通常のjqueryセレクタを使用して、XMLファイル内のノードを見つけることができます。その後、Javascript/JQueryを使用してHTMLファイルにデータを挿入することができます。 PHPのSimpleXMLでも同じです。実際には、任意のXMLリーダーを使用してXMLを読み取ることができ、それを出力するために好きな方法を使用できます。

XSLTが一致する場合、 XMLをHTMLに変換してコードを記述することはできません。つまり、XSLTを書く必要がありますが、これはおそらく同様に多くの作業です。

関連する問題